What kind of mount did you use for that shot?
It's a suction cup mount from FilmTools. I've only used it a little so far, but I'm quite impressed. The head's fiddly, but it seems to work well. I kind of want to use a ball-head with it, too, but this is a good start. It's kind of an alternative to the VacuCam, but this can be used with a much wider array of cameras.
